I typically only borrow books that I do not want to buy. My library is part of a regional collective and I have access to ebooks from 10 additional libraries with my local library card, so I can almost always find a copy of a book that I am looking for. The exception is book club books; we haven't figured out how to choose books that aren't on a huge waitlist and I'm the only ebook reader, so I always have the longest wait. I just buy those through iBooks so that they don't clutter up my other "bookshelves."

(I am the rare one that doesn't download my books. I have tried, but I am no longer interested in the subjectively tedious process of cataloging books that I may never access. I'm still moving and organizing my files of books from when I was determined to manage them all on my own, but in practice, when I want to read a book, I go back to the store account and download directly from wherever I purchased it.)
